I want to start with the motivation which led me to this topic. Few months
ago I wanted to introduce Otto (https://www.ottoproject.io/) to Nix. I was
starting with Nix back then i tried to do things as they were in
go-packages.nix.
So I created otto as buildFromGithub[1] and use its bin output in
all-packages.nix[2]. Next nix-build -A otto and I got 23 dependencies
missing[3]. So I started to add dependencies manually doing  nix-build -A
otto tens of times because each of them depends on new things that `go
build` tells me only when I add new sources for build... [4]
After many hours of doing nix-build and new edits in go-packages.nix I
ended up with otto done in 400 lines of Nix [5] I don't want do maintain.
Besides new packages I also need to change version of things that were
there before, potentially breaking other things. I can't even image how
many hours of work it'll cost me to update it to new version :( So there no
otto in nixpkgs.
Instead of making otto I've started go2nix[6] prototype where I want to use
Go toolchain because it can find out all transitive dependencies in one go.
It wasn't hard to write a prototype in Go because everthing for it is
there. So after a minutes I could automatically generate a list of all
dependencies that I need to build any Go binary! Next step was to generate
working Nix expression with this list of dependencies that can be used in
goPackages. How hard can it be? :) It turned out that it's impossible to do
this reusing goPackages in its current state. How could I know that:
* github.com/ugorji/go sould be ugorji.go [7]
* gopkg.in/flosch/pongo2.v3 should be pongo2 [8]
* google.golang.org/api should be google-api-go-client [9]
* github.com/odeke-em/google-api-go-client shoul be
odeke-em.google-api-go-client
[10]
* github.com/stathat/go should be stathat [11]
...

So there were 2 ways of dealing it:
* generate new goPackage without any imports from go-packages.nix and
abandon it completely
* change go-packages.nix into something that can be readable for something
that knows how packages are named in Go land
I thought that go-packages.nix, python-packages.nix ...... says that we
want to reuse common dependencies somewhere but it should be possible to
override some of them if needed. And that was the beginning of [WIP] Rework
goPackages with go-packages.nix "converted" into libs.json that was also
influenced by temptation to make it possible to automate future updates[12].
